depends first you probly dont need to worry about camber. If you drop it just a bit the front camber is more forgiving. You can do the rears for 15 bucks, do a search for 15 dollar camber mod. If you go nuts with drop DO CAMBER or buy tires every 6 to 8 months your choice.
